In 10 ml of DMF was suspended 1.19 g (30.0 mmol) of 60% sodium hydride, and 3.07 ml (30.0 mmol) of thiophenol in 20 ml of DMF was dropwised under ice-cooling. After the mixture was stirred at ice-cooling for 10 minutes, 5.74 g (10.0 mmol) of Compound 10 obtained in Example 10 in DMF (50 ml) was added at ice-cooling, then the reaction mixture was stirred at 150° C. for 20 hours. After the reaction mixture was cooled to room temperature, water was added, pH of the reaction mixture was adjusted at 5 by concentrated hydrochloric acid and was subjected to extraction with chloroform. The organic layer was washed with sodium chloride solution and dried, concentrated to give residue which was purified by silica gel column chromatography (eluent: chloroform/methanol=50/1). The more polar product obtained was recrystallized from ethanol/ether to give 2.67 g (yield: 49%) of Compound 47 as white crystals.
